Do not attempt to charge non-rechargeable disposable Alkaline batteries. The batteries may leak and damage your mouse or keyboard.
Changing the batteries • It’s recommended that you fully charge the batteries before initial use; nevertheless it’s ready for set up (see next step) anytime during charging. • Connect the charging cable (included in the box) to the USB RF receiver’s charging port and the mouse. (Repeat this step later for the keyboard.) • Plug the receiver’s USB connector to your computer’s available USB port. • The initial charging process may take up to 8 hours.
computer. (Note: it’s not necessary to wait for the batteries to be fully charged before connecting to your system.) Make sure the computer’s power management is set to disable hibernation mode while the products are being charged. (Go to Control Panel, Power Options, select “Hibernate” from the tabs and uncheck the box marked “Enable Hibernation.

Operating Tips & Trouble Shooting • Optical mouse works best on non-reflective, non-white, surface. If cursor movements are lagging, placing the mouse on a mouse pad will help. Darker surface requires more energy to operate thus consumes more battery power. • If you will not use the keyboard and mouse for a long period of time remove the batteries from the respective battery compartments. • When the keyboard and/or mouse behave erratically it may be an indication that the battery power is low.
• Once the keyboard and mouse are connected to the RF receiver they stay connected even when the device is turned off and out of range. If for any reason the connection to the system is lost, first check if the RF receiver is still plugged in to your computer and verify that your keyboard and mouse are within 33-foot/10-meter from your computer. If the connection is lost it can be fixed by following the instructions in the Connecting the Keyboard and Mouse to the Computer section to reconnect the devices.
